Air Conditioning
For apartments:
Too warm? Adjust the thermostat (in the hallway) to a more comfortable cooler temperature and allow some time for the A/C to kick in and for the apartment to cool down. (Also make sure windows are closed when A/C is on.)
Too cold? Adjust the thermostat (in the hallway) to a more comfortable warmer temperature and allow some time for the A/C to go off and the apartment to warm up. The A/C will be off, but the fan will continue to run and circulate air. Feel free to open a window once the A/C is off.
For residence halls/dorms:
Use the temperature control knobs on the individual air-conditioning units to regulate the temperature. Make sure air-conditioning is off before opening windows and windows are closed when air-conditioning is on.
Heat
For apartments and residence halls/dorms:
All apartments and most residence halls employ a seasonal heating/ cooling system, set to heat from October through April and to聽air conditioning from April through October. Heat is therefore not available in those locations during the summer months (but guests can turn off the air-conditioning).

Desktop computers聽are available for public use in Falvey Library. You will need your Wildcard to enter the building and will have access to two courtesy patron computers designated for visitor use. Open any browser to access your e-mail via the Internet. No print services available.
Wireless internet聽via the VUGuest wireless network is also available for guests bringing their own laptops (see below on how to connect).
Throughout Campus
- Connect to the 鈥淰UGuest鈥 (NOT 鈥淰UMobile鈥) wireless network and open any browser.
- Once the network log-in page opens in your browser, follow the instructions to create a Guest Account (valid for seven days at a time) and obtain your individual username and password, which will be sent to your cell phone via text message. (If you do not have a cell phone or are an international guest without a U.S. cell phone and therefore unable to receive text messages, please contact your group leader or Conference Services.) Once you receive your username and password (instantly, via text message), enter them and click 鈥淪ubmit鈥.聽
- After successful log-in and connection to the network, you will be redirected to the TikTok成人版 Homepage and are now able to access any website. Do not connect any of your own equipment (routers etc.).
Please contact Conference Services at 610-519-5554 (seven days a week, 7am 鈥 9pm,) or TikTok成人版 IT鈥檚 Helpdesk at 610-519-7777 (Mon 鈥 Thu, 8am 鈥 7pm and Fri, 8am 鈥 5pm) with any questions or connectivity problems.

Adding Nova Bucks
Guests can add Nova Bucks directly to the Wildcard (Wildcard Restricted Debit Account) they receive at Check-In by going to the Wildcard Office in Dougherty Hall (Mon 鈥 Thu, 8am 鈥 5pm, and Fri, 8am 鈥 12pm, Phone: 610-519-6202). Nova Bucks can also be added anytime using one of the two revalue machines outside of the Wildcard Office (one accepts cash bills, one accepts credit cards (no AmEx)). Unused Nova Bucks on any Wildcard cannot be refunded 鈥 depositing small amounts at a time is therefore recommended. Wildcards and therefore Nova Bucks expire on the last day of a guest鈥檚 stay.
Using Nova Bucks/Purchases
Wildcard Nova Bucks can be used for purchases at the following: a la carte dining operations and convenience stores, University Bookstore, Barber Shop and a variety of off-campus vendors.
Wildcards are disposable and do not need to be returned at the end of your stay. However, there will be a $10 replacement fee if a Wildcard is lost during your stay and a replacement card is issued.

There is a SEPTA Regional Rail (Paoli/Thorndale Local line) station on campus connecting the campus eastward with Center City Philadelphia, the Philadelphia AMTRAK train station, and the Philadelphia Airport as well as various western suburban destinations. Also on campus are two SEPTA Norristown High-Speed Line stations with connections to Valley Forge National Park and the King of Prussia Mall. Xfinity cable TV access is complimentary in all apartments and聽residence hall rooms, but guests must provide their own TV and coaxial cable. TVs must be able to accept a coax cable input and must be equipped with a QAM tuner. For broken coax cable wall jacks or with questions about how to connect or program their TV, guests should call Conference Services at 610-519-5554. If the issue cannot be resolved, call TikTok成人版 IT (UNIT) at 610-519-7777. Xfinity on Campus (streaming TV) is not available to summer guests
Smart TVs: To connect your smart TVs to the VUPlay (not VUGuest) wireless network, call Conference Services at 610-519-5554 to obtain a username and password.
